Jennifer Webster is a seasoned voice over artist with extensive experience in various campaigns and projects across multiple platforms. Currently working with the Theodore Roosevelt Conservation Partnership since February 2019, Jennifer specializes in social growth campaigns, documentaries, and internal videos, all produced from a home studio. Additionally, Jennifer contributes to DMWeiss Productions on the Nebraska Family Hotline, creating multiple commercial and radio spots recognized with a Telly Award. Past roles include producing learning videos for Relias and narrating audiobooks for Audible. Jennifer's educational background includes a Bachelor of Fine Arts in Theatre from the Boston Conservatory at Berklee.

In 1912 Theodore Roosevelt said, “There can be no greater issue than that of conservation in this country.” While in the political arena, he succeeded in making conservation a top tier national issue. T.R. had the foresight to address these issues still so significant to sportsmen today, understanding that if we want to ensure critical habitat, special hunting grounds and secret fishing holes will be around for future generations, we must plan carefully today. We guarantee all Americans quality places to hunt and fish by uniting and amplifying our partners’ voices to strengthen federal policy and funding.
